Alternative Methods in Innovative Jewelry Design with CAD-CAM: Polymeric Metarial and Laser Sintering
Abstract
In the jewelry sector, production has been made using many technologies and techniques since ancient times. The main purpose here is that the production of a jewelry is in line with the criteria of mass production, speed, aesthetics, light weight and marketable. In addition to these, hand-made jewelery, as well as designs from different materials are produced with computer-aided production methods. Thanks to CAD, designs drawn in various computer programs can be produced with different materials in three dimensions by the CAM method. Thanks to this production technique, designs drawn on the computer can be obtained with different materials. These products provide variety according to the type of material and production technique. For many years, in the jewelery industry, products were produced with three-dimensional printers using wax, resins etc. and then sent to the casting. In recent years, different production methods have been developed thanks to the technology developed with 3D printers. Some of these methods will be examined in this study. These are three-dimensional production techniques with laser metal sintering and SLS from polymeric material (polyamide). Thanks to the production of jewelry and objects made with different materials, it is possible to design products freely. In this study; The advantages and disadvantages of sintering, polyamide and sls, which are produced with computer-aided manufacturing methods, will be discussed and information will be given about alternative contributions and reflections to jewelry design in the jewelry industry.
